#3bd0ad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3bd0ad is composed of 23.1% red, 81.6% green and 67.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 16.8%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 165.9 degrees, a saturation of 61.3% and a lightness of 52.4%. #3bd0ad color hex could be obtained by blending #76ffff with #00a15b. Closest websafe color is: #33cc99.

Shades and Tints of #3bd0ad

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020a08 is the darkest color, while #f9fefc is the lightest one.
